- Q The wind was west and west steered we.
West was right aft and how could that be?
A The captains name was West.
Q Why is the Bay of Biscay like a Christmas cake?
A Because it contains so many currents.
Q How many black hens go to make a white hen?
A One, when she is plucked.
Q Why is a barber the smallest man in the world?
A Because he get up a "lather" to shave.
Q If I started to build a wall from the Hook up to Rosslare about the height of a house what height would it be when I would have it finished?
A The height of nonsense.(continues on next page)- Collector
